Engine Oil Cooler: Removal

CAUTION:
If engine oil is spilt onto the exhaust pipe, wipe it off with cloth to avoid emission of smoke or causing a fire.
- Drain engine coolant. <Ref. to DRAINING OF ENGINE COOLANT , REPLACEMENT, Engine Coolant.>
- Remove the engine oil filter. <Ref. to REMOVAL , Engine Oil Filter.>
- Remove the bolt (B) holding the oil cooler pipe (A) to the oil pump.
- Remove the oil cooler pipe (A), oil cooler hose A (C), oil cooler hose B (H), and oil cooler hose C (I).
- Remove the oil cooler connector (D) and oil cooler (E).
